From dbaa925494151dc8af72933cd35f22b2f95f654f Mon Sep 17 00:00:00 2001
From: jkito <belter@riseup.net>
Date: Sat, 27 Jul 2024 21:11:50 +0530
Subject: [PATCH] kcp: set transport to KCP if it is set in config file

---
 pkg/bitmask/init.go | 7 +++++++
 1 file changed, 7 insertions(+)

diff --git a/pkg/bitmask/init.go b/pkg/bitmask/init.go
index 71bde654..ebb4b0db 100644
--- a/pkg/bitmask/init.go
+++ b/pkg/bitmask/init.go
@@ -109,6 +109,13 @@ func setTransport(b Bitmask, conf *config.Config) error {
 			return err
 		}
 	}
+	if conf.KCP {
+		log.Info().Msg("Using transport kcp")
+		err := b.SetTransport("kcp")
+		if err != nil {
+			return err
+		}
+	}
 	return nil
 }
 
-- 
GitLab